Description: This manual aims to provide drop-in staff with a clear outline of standards and policies to be implemented in all Healthy Respect accredited
drop-ins. It is a working document giving resources and practical information. It reflects current Healthy Respect, NHS Lothian and Scottish Government policies and the existing evidence of effective sexual health interventions. The standards have been developed in close consultation with young people as well as a wide range of professionals. The manual should be used by all staff working in Healthy Respect accredited
drop-ins including nurses, doctors, receptionists, community learning and development staff and youth workers.

Description: This handbook compliments the all I want-LIVE Standards as a day-to-day working handbook for use in Healthy Respect drop-ins. It is a working document with easy access to activities, contacts, forms and protocols. This handbook is for all staff operating Healthy Respect accredited drop-ins including nurses, doctors, community learning and development staff and youth workers.
